Daniel “Danny” Clay Godfrey, 68, of Nashville, Ark., passed away, Tuesday, Dec. 20, 2022, in Nashville. Danny was born Aug. 4, 1954, in Conroe, Texas, to the late Clay and Margaret Ann See Godfrey. Danny was a retired cattle rancher and horse-shoer. He was a member of the Cross Point Cowboy Church. Danny loved the cowboy lifestyle, raising his horses and working cattle. He loved sitting around and telling stories like cowboys do.
